Bay of Bengal Maritime Boundary Arbitration between Bangladesh and India (Bangladesh v. India)

On 7 July 2014, the Arbitral Tribunal constituted under Annex VII of the United Nations Convention on the Law of the Sea in the Bay of Bengal Maritime Boundary Arbitration (Bangladesh v. India) rendered its Award. The Award establishes the course of the maritime boundary line between Bangladesh and India in the territorial sea, the exclusive economic zone, and the continental shelf within and beyond 200 nautical miles.

Permanent Court of Arbitration enters into Host Country Agreement with Vietnam

On 23 June 2014, at a ceremony held at the Government Guest House in Hanoi, the Secretary-General of the Permanent Court of Arbitration, H.E. Mr. Hugo Hans Siblesz, and the First Vice-Minister of Foreign Affairs of the Socialist Republic of Viet Nam, H.E. Mr. Ho Xuan Son, signed a Host Country Agreement that would facilitate the PCA’s work in conducting arbitral proceedings within the country. The Agreement took effect immediately upon signing. At the ceremony, letters of cooperation between Viet Nam and the PCA were also exchanged.

PCA holds hearing in Mauritius

The Permanent Court of Arbitration (PCA) has concluded a two-day hearing in the Republic of Mauritius in an arbitration between an African company and an African State. The hearing marks the first occasion on which the PCA has held hearings in Mauritius under the 2009 PCA-Mauritius Host Country Agreement.

PCA Responds to Queries on Arbitral Legitimacy

The PCA was recently asked by ICCA to answer a questionnaire on arbitral legitimacy and expound on this subject at the 2014 ICCA Congress in Miami. The questionnaire covered topics such as the participation of arbitration users and practitioners based in developing arbitral jurisdictions, the role of institutions in arbitral appointment and decision-making processes, and the effects of rising costs in international arbitration.

Cooperation Agreement with the Centre for Arbitration and Conciliation of the Chamber of Commerce of Bogotá

At a ceremony held on 12 May 2014, the Permanent Court of Arbitration (PCA) and the Centre for Arbitration and Conciliation of the Chamber of Commerce of Bogotá (CAC-CCB) entered into a formal cooperation agreement. This agreement will strengthen ties between the CAC-CCB and the PCA. Each institution will be able to hold hearings and meetings at the other’s premises and will assist with the arrangement of local support services for such events.

The PCA Peace Palace Centenary Seminar, October 11, 2013

The PCA will hold a seminar on October 11, 2013, for invitees only, to commemorate the centenary of the Peace Palace. The Peace Palace was constructed, through the generous donation of Andrew
Carnegie, in order to house the Permanent Court of Arbitration. Formally inaugurated on August 28, 1913, and maintained ever since by the Carnegie Foundation, the Peace Palace has come to be recognized globally as the icon of international peace and justice.
